NOT

工作常用的EXCEL公式 | 一个工作簿拆分成多个工作簿(VBA)

需求:一个工作簿拆分成多个工作簿 解决方法:VBA代码 方法1:自选路径 Sub EachShtToWorkbook() Dim sht As Worksheet, strPath As String With Application.FileDialog(msoFileDialogFolderPi ......
公式 多个 常用 EXCEL VBA

java-EasyExcel模板导出

前言: 需求:根据自定义模板导出Excel,包含图片、表格,采用EasyExcel 提示:EasyExcel请使用 3.0 以上版本, 对图片操作最重要的类就是 WriteCellData<Void> 如果你的easyexcel没有这个类,说明你的版本太低,请升级到3.0以上 <dependency ......
java-EasyExcel EasyExcel 模板 java

SQL提高查询性能的几种方式

## 创建索引,提高性能 索引可以极大地提高查询性能,其背后的原理:1. 索引是的数据库引擎能够快速的找到表中的数据,它们类似于书籍的目录,使得你不需要逐页查找所需要的信息2. 索引能够帮助数据库引擎直接定位到所需的数据,从而大大减少磁盘I/O操作,如果没有索引,SQL SERSER可能需要执行全表 ......
性能 方式 SQL

execl表格if函数and和or的使用方法?

通过灵活使用IF函数、AND函数和OR函数,您可以根据各种条件进行复杂的逻辑判断,并根据判断结果返回不同的值。上述公式会判断A1是否大于10且B1小于20或C1等于"Yes"。只有当A1大于10且B1小于20或C1等于"Yes"时,公式返回"满足条件";=IF(AND(A1>10, OR(B1<20... ......
使用方法 函数 表格 方法 execl

MySQL大表设计怎么做?

MySQL大表设计,MySQL大表优化,MySQL数据库设计原则,MySQL索引设计,分页查询优化,数据库性能优化,数据导入与备份,查询性能优化,数据库定期维护,MySQL高可用设计 ......
MySQL

【虹科分享】亚运会赛果可视化分析

书接上回,武林高手同台比武,打得热火朝天,历经16日,终于落下帷幕,各路英雄再归于江河湖海。这期间,新鲜事层出不穷,要说各位最爱聊的,还得是谁胜谁负。这不,在下又上科技与绝活了!HK-Domo可视化仪表板,通过采集亚运会相关数据,进行可视化展示。 HK-Domo可视化仪表板,通过采集亚运会相关数据, ......
赛果 亚运会

IT行业自学网站,给大家分享下!!!

以下五个自学网站,给大家分享下,课程资源很丰富,大家学习期间有一些不懂的的技术问题,都可以通过这几个网站进行学习!! 1.泓优网络 地址:程序猿梦工厂_泓优网络 (hyouit.com) 目前是国内IT课程最全、最新的一个网站,自己平时有很多不懂的地方都会到这个网站来学习,它有大量超清IT职业教程, ......
行业 网站

C# 中定义自己的ThreadPoolQueue

一 背景 在实际的开发过程中,我们经常有一种需求就是我们的任务需要放到线程池中进行执行,并且这些任务需要逐一放到 Queue中进行独立的执行,而且要保证其高效,所以今天分享一个用于解决这样的一个场景的CxThreadPoolQueue类用于解决这个问题。 二 源码及分析 2.1 源码展示 using ......
ThreadPoolQueue

WPF DataTomplate中Command无效

在工作中需要用到DataTomplate来更改表单里的样式,发现Command无效。网上搜索发现是因为DataContext指代不明,,需要改为父类的DataContext。 解决方法:需要RelativeSource手动指定DataContext和Command。使用如下所示: Command=" ......
DataTomplate Command WPF

CSS 选择符 前缀

1]CSS选择器超详细汇总 2]30个你必须记住的CSS选择符 3]CSS 选择器 ......
前缀 CSS

nacos 2.2.3版本开启登录认证

server.tomcat.basedir=/root/nacos #此路径必须存在 nacos.core.auth.system.type=nacos nacos.core.auth.enabled=true nacos.core.auth.server.identity.key=serverId ......
版本 nacos

Teamcenter SOA开发创建时间表,已经挂在父任务上,但在时间表管理器中没有显示出来。

1、我创建时间表任务的,已经指明了要挂在指定的父级任务下。 然后我在时间表管理器中并没有看到这个任务。但是我通过查看属性,刚创建的子任务,的确已经是挂到父任务下了。 2、后来通过尝试,把创建任务的开始和结束时间加上去 。 果然可以了。 看来创建任务的时候,要默认把开始和结束时间加上去。 ......
时间表 时间 Teamcenter 任务 SOA

如何判断一个值为对象类型

使用typeof判断(不推荐); let a = {}; typeof a; //object let a = []; typeof a;//object let a = null; typeof a;//object 缺点是:使用typeof时,数组和null判断结果都为对象类型所以不推荐 使用i ......
对象 类型

如何按“单元格格式”筛选数据

起因 因为Yu童孩想要筛选单元格是否是“非数值”类得格式 思路 既然是筛选单元格格式,我们需要嘴的就是找到格式相关得操作或者函数 graph LR 格式相关操作 条件格式 格式相关操作 is类函数 格式相关操作 定位条件 定位条件 也就是常说得快捷键(F5) 对应操作为: graph LR 开始选项 ......
单元 格式 数据

Mysql使用记录

1. 安装 sudo apt-get install mysql-server 问题:mysql -u root -p 或 mysql -u your_user_name -p时出现如下error:出现错误: ERROR 1045 (28000): Access denied for user 'w ......
Mysql

串口调试助手

uartQT 1. uartAssist.pro 添加如下两行 QT += serialport RC_ICONS = myIco.ico 2. 绘制UI界面 3. 初始化对象和私有变量 private: Ui::Widget *ui; QSerialPort *serialPort; long r ......
串口 助手

C# 将dll封装进exe/将dll打包进exe/将dll合并进exe

step1:NuGet安装Costura.Fody和Fody step2:安装后,打开根目录下的FodyWeavers.xml文件,将内容替换如下后,再执行编译即可封装dll <Weavers x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" ......
dll exe

Codeforces Round 910 (Div. 2)

Preface 这场其实挺早之前就写完代码了,但一直没时间写博客(玩云顶新赛季玩的) 感觉F其实不难但为什么就是想不出来呢,感觉后面的题就是很难突破的说 A. Milica and String 分类讨论+枚举即可 #include<cstdio> #include<iostream> #inclu ......
Codeforces Round 910 Div

5.项目冲刺(4)

今日完成项目 学号+姓名 任务安排 20211405周睿雅 交互设计 20211420杨谨徽 性能优化 20211421文鑫河 兼容性测试 20211423袁艺 用户体验测试 20211425高政 前端部署 Gitee 链接 https://gitee.com/SHIBATORI/document- ......
项目

笔记 | 使用 Turf.js 实现等值线/面

一、准备工作,所使用到的工具及API Turf.js 使用的 API 如下: featureCollection interpolate isobands Leaflet.js 使用的 API 如下: FeatureGroup geoJSON 二、必要知识点介绍 isobands(pointGrid ......
等值线 笔记 Turf js

ELK

一、安装镜像 docker pull elasticsearch:7.2.0docker pull mobz/elasticsearch-head:5docker pull kibana:7.2.0docker pull logstash:7.2.0 二、安装ElasticSearch 1. doc ......
ELK

eclipse查看一个方法被谁引用(调用)的快捷键四种方式

1.(首推)双击选中该方法,Ctrl+Alt+H 如果你想知道一个类的方法到底被那些其他的类调用,那么请选中这个方法名,然后按“Ctrl+Alt+H”, Eclipse就会显示出这个方法被哪些方法调用,最终产生一个调用关系树。 2.(次推)选中该方法,Ctrl+Shift+G 就显示这个方法被谁引用 ......
快捷键 eclipse 方式 方法

Flutter 修改 APP 名称

flutter pubspec.yaml dependencies: flutter_app_name: ^0.1.0 flutter_app_name: name: "托尼蛋儿" web H5 lib/routes/App.dart import 'package:flutter/cupertin ......
名称 Flutter APP

python 生成器

生成器 生成器:当函数中使用了yield关键字那么该函数就是生成器 yield关键字跟return功能一样:可以返回值,并且结束当前函数的执行 核心区别是下次调用该函数会从yield下一行继续执行代码 def func(): print(1) print(2) yield "卡点1" print(3 ......
生成器 python

PLC通过lora网关采集温室大棚温湿度数据

概述: 运用lora网关远程控制大棚内风机,日光灯,温湿度传感器等设备。可以实现远程获取现场环境的空气温湿度、土壤水分温度、二氧化碳浓度、光照强度可以自动控制温室湿帘风机、喷淋滴灌、加温补光等设备,并向远程计算机端推送实时数据,实现现场环境信息化,智能化远程管理。减少人工成本,降低人工成本,提高工作 ......
温室大棚 大棚 温室 网关 数据

工作常用的EXCEL公式 | vlookup和match函数的应用

数据源: 返回多列结果: ......
公式 函数 常用 vlookup EXCEL

字节2面真题,你能答对几道?

字节跳动的面试难度,放眼整个互联网都是“遥遥领先”!不能说有多难,就是看了都不会的哪种!当然,这句话是开玩笑的。 咱们先来看下字节二面的所有问题: 前半部分的问题比较简单,相信大部人都能搞定(如果你搞不定,可以偷偷去看磊哥的武林秘籍:https://www.javacn.site)。本文咱们就挑两个 ......
真题 字节

P6326 Shopping 题解

非常好题目。 思路 考虑题目需要求一个连通块的背包。 点分治是平凡的,很容易想到,因为要统计的东西恰好可以把树分成几段。 但点分治操作时的背包确实卡了一下。 以前也没有见过这样的做法。 我们考虑如果直接做树上背包的话。 复杂度是绝对受不了的。 因为合并两个多重背包是基于值域的。 无法体现在树上的优势 ......
题解 Shopping P6326 6326

Linux驱动开发: FrameBuffe(LCD)驱动开发

一、FrameBuffer 帧缓冲设备的原理 1.1 概念 在linux系统中LCD这类设备称为帧缓冲设备,英文frameBuffer设备。 frameBuffer 是出现在2.2.xx 内核当中的一种驱动程序接口。 帧缓冲(framebuffer)是Linux 系统为显示设备提供的一个接口,它将显 ......
FrameBuffe Linux LCD

Docker 常用命令

镜像(Image)篇 1. 查看Docker 中已有的镜像 docker image ls 还有一个docker images 这是一个旧版的命令,自 Docker 17.06 版本引入docker image 的命令 参数 -a 列表出有的镜像 2. 搜索镜像 docker search ubun ......
命令 常用 Docker